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Darnall to Hamble start from as little as £26.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Darnall to Hamble start from £82.20 one way, or £141.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Darnall to Hamble are available for £148.20 one way, or £296.20 return

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Darnall might be a smaller station with a touch of old-world simplicity, but it's designed to accommodate passengers with fundamental needs. While there's no formal ticket office, ticket machines are handy for any collections or purchases, although they're currently not accessible. If you're tech-savvy, collecting tickets bought online from these machines is straightforward. While staff assistance isn't present, help points and announcements are your go-to for any immediate guidance.

Accessibility is a standout feature, with the station rated as Category A, indicating step-free access throughout. A ramped subway provides convenience for wheelchair users, though it is noteworthy that there are no accessible ticket machines or facilities such as toilets or waiting rooms available. Find your platform with ease using a 360-degree map of the station here.

Onward Travel Options

Connectivity doesn't stop at Darnall's platforms. While the local bus service may not have stops right next to the station, rail replacement services are available nearby at Main Road & Station Road junction. For those needing a quick taxi, Cab4You offers a streamlined service that can be accessed at https://www.northernrailway.co.uk/tickets/cab4you. Unfortunately, the bike facilities are non-existent, but the region’s straightforward layout makes alternative arrangements quite feasible.

Facilities and Services at Hamble Station

At Hamble station, ticketing is made convenient, with ticket machines available for purchasing and collecting tickets. These are accessible and also offer discounts for those with a Disabled Persons Railcard, ensuring that everyone can travel with ease. While the station doesn't boast a ticket office or smartcard issuance, it does provide smartcard validation facilities for those using this modern fare system.

Travelers will appreciate the help points dotted around the station, though staff assistance is generally unavailable on site. If you require support, a customer service center can be contacted. Additionally, audio and visual information is furnished through departure screens and announcements, ensuring you stay informed about your travels. CCTV is operational, contributing to the safety and security of the station's users.

Accessibility and Comfort

Some of the drawbacks at Hamble include the lack of accessible toilets, waiting rooms, or lounges, but there's a silver lining—step-free access is offered at certain points via footpaths from Hamble Lane. Nevertheless, please note that the route involves a steep section on the platform towards Portsmouth, making it challenging for some. It’s advised that wheelchair users contact the Assisted Travel team for support if needed.

For cyclists, there are a handful of bicycle storage spaces available, too. This can be handy if you’re planning to take in the scenic routes around the coastal village or head further afield.

Onward Travel from Hamble

When it comes to traveling beyond the station, Hamble offers a variety of options. It's worth noting that the station doesn't provide direct rail replacement services on site, but buses stop nearby at Hound Corner.
